What are the features and benefits of spider couplings?
Torsionally flexible
Curved-jaw spider couplings have a high level of torsional elasticity, meaning that they are accommodating of both parallel and angular misalignments.
Dampening
These couplings are dampening of both vibration and shock loads, helping to protect surrounding equipment from harsh operating conditions.
Fail-safe
Curved-jaw Spider couplings are fail safe. This means that even if the spider element fails, the coupling will continue to function. This reduces the risk of damage to surrounding equipment, as well as unplanned downtime.
Maintenance-free
These couplings do not require any further maintenance after fitting as they are lubrication free. This eliminates the need for downtime, as well as costly maintenance practices.
Curved-Jaw Spider Couplings FAQs
What is a curved-jaw spider coupling?
A curved-jaw spider coupling is a flexible shaft coupling designed to connect two rotating shafts while reducing vibration, shock, and minor misalignment. The curved jaws and elastomer spider help transmit torque smoothly in industrial machinery.
What are curved-jaw couplings used for?
Curved-jaw couplings are commonly used in:
-
Electric motors
-
Pumps
-
Gearboxes
-
Compressors
-
Conveyor systems
-
General industrial power transmission equipment
They help protect machinery while maintaining efficient torque transfer.
How do I choose the right curved-jaw coupling?
When selecting a curved-jaw spider coupling consider:
-
Shaft size
-
Required torque
-
Speed (RPM)
-
Operating environment
-
Misalignment tolerance
-
Spider material
Choosing the correct specification ensures optimal performance and longer service life.
